Srinagar: Lieutenant Governor  Manoj Sinha highlighted the growing spirit of sportsmanship and the remarkable transformation of Jammu and Kashmir under the leadership of the Prime Minister Narendra Modi which laid the foundation for organising big events here.

Thanking the Prime Minister, Sinha emphasized how the government’s sustained efforts in restoring peace and stability to the region have paved the way for such events. He mentioned, “The way the Prime Minister has been working to bring peace to Jammu and Kashmir is one of the key reasons why a marathon of this magnitude can be held here today,” he said according to KNS correspondent.

The event featured both a full marathon and a half marathon, with participants from all over the country and abroad. Sinha expressed his gratitude to CS Duloo, who conceived the idea of the Srinagar marathon three months ago. The Lieutenant Governor also thanked the various government departments for their role in organizing the event, praising the coordination and the vibrant atmosphere of the city.

“The lights of Srinagar shining today are a testament to the city’s growing spirit, and the praise for it is limitless,” Sinha said, adding that a marathon is not just about winning or losing but about participation and community spirit.

The event saw enthusiastic participation, with runners from 12 different countries joining to celebrate the spirit of unity. Sinha noted, “This marathon has become a signature event, symbolizing freedom, dedication, and the indomitable spirit of the people of Jammu and Kashmir.”

The LG also lauded the government’s commitment to infrastructure development in the region, signaling a bright future for Jammu and Kashmir. With international participation and growing support for sports initiatives, the marathon has further highlighted the region’s journey towards peace and prosperity.

Sinha also reiterated his pride in being part of this movement, celebrating the spirit of sportsmanship that continues to unite and inspire the people of Jammu and Kashmir. (KNS)
